Certain advantages of living in a large city City life and rural life are absolutely the different sides of the coin, so choosing whether to live in a big city or a small town requires serious consideration. Each city has its unique aspects and qualities that distinguish itself from others. Each person has his or her own opinion about where to live based on his or her life style. However, according to me, living in a large city has certain advantages over living in a small town: convenient public transportation, greater entertainment facility and higher employment. To begin with, a metropolitan city has its obvious advantage when it comes to the public transportation. It is wildly known that a big city has extremely convenient transportation which can be best illustrated by the example of New York, where the subway runs twenty-four hours for seven days a week and there are tremendous cabs and buses everywhere. Not to mention that the transport system is always fast, safe, clean and affordable.
For the poor, who can only rely on the public transportation, such a convenient and efficient system makes it much easier for them to seek work opportunities far from their living houses and also gives them greater access to education, healthcare and recreation. In addition to public transportation, what makes people pour into big city is its wonderful entertainment facility. Many small towns often offer less social amenities than expected due to its demographic and geographic factors. Whereas, countless facilities of entertainment and cultural activities such as cinemas, theatres, concerts, museums can be found in a large city like Shanghai with the least effort and time. Such facilities not only offer people a place where they can be relaxed after a week’s hard work, but also can nurture the soul and cultivate the mind to some extent, which is particularly beneficial to children who are willing to visit some historical museums during their spare time.
Finally, higher employment is another reason why people prefer urban areas. On the one hand, there are a lot of headquarters for large companies in major cities as well as large factories, so the average employed person is a step higher on the ladder than they will be in smaller cities. And it is likely that people will find something that specifically matches their skills. For instance, a friend of mine who majors in software engineering can easily find a related job in big cities while he may find the different line of work if he is in rural areas. On the other hand, statistics show that people in large cities are more likely to have a Bachelor’s degree or better, which contributes to the high employment and better payment. Taken all of the above reasons into consideration, small towns cannot be compared with big cities in public transportation, entertainment facilities and job opportunities. Although, small towns are more tranquil and peaceful, if a person pursues a fast-pace and colorful life, major cities are his or her best choice.
Living in an urban center can be great if you enjoy the hustle and bustle and want to be close to the action and new possibilities. Check out some financial, cultural and lifestyle benefits of living in the city.

1. Public Transportation & Walk ability

Access can be considered the main perk of living in an urban center. While cost of parking can be expensive in the city, many urban dwellers ditch the cars and high gas, insurance and maintenance prices for traveling by foot, bike or public transit. Most large cities boast bus or train systems that run regularly and offer affordable rates that allow residents the opportunity to be mobile. This can make traveling from one location to another much more convenient and cost-effective.

2. Attractions & Entertainment

Whether it is green space, museums, theater, music venues or other cultural attractions, most cities have an array of options for spending your free time. Many cities have cultural programs, free or affordable options and incentives to enjoy the entertainment and attractions available. Among the skyscrapers, stores, and office buildings, the entertainment and culture in cities can be a big reason to settle there. Some cities are growing faster than others.

3. Restaurants & Shopping

Large urban areas offer other experiences that may not be available in small towns as well. From ethnic food stores and restaurants to boutiques and specialty department stores, living in the city provides unique dining and shopping experiences.

4. Social Possibilities & Networking

With thousands and even millions of people living in close proximity, cities have unlimited social potential for friends and networking. While those with similar interests or backgrounds separate into many neighborhoods, cities also experience great diversity in common spaces. Urban life offers a chance to broaden your professional contacts and personal relationships.

5. Medical Care & Service for Seniors

Living in a city allows the opportunity to get care in a major medical institution and services and assistance for seniors. Getting help in a large city can occur more quickly and even more specialized in a city rather than suburbia or a rural area.
While there are several benefits of living in an urban center, some challenges exist as well. Cost of living, noise and lack of space cause many to live on the outskirts and commute to work or even search for the rural life. Be prepared to make the most of small space and pay for increased access if you are moving into the city. It’s important to weigh the pros and cons specific to your situation before making the choice of where to live. For some the benefits of living in the city will be enough of a lure but for others, a turn-off.
While many people feel that a big city is a good place to live, I believe that the opposite is true. The following essay will demonstrate exactly why the latter position is more persuasive than the former.
Firstly, big cities bring more pollution than small towns such as smog, noise, and traffic. In the long run, the environment will be damaged and people's health will suffer.
For example, noise is environmental pollution. Particularly in congested urban area, the noise that is produced by our advancing technology causes physical and psychological harm, and detracts from quality of life for people who are exposed to it.
Secondly, Small towns are more personal and secure than big cities. In small town, People are usually known about each other's personal lives such as jobs, children's name, ages, and hobbies. Moreover, people normally know who owns the local stores or restaurants. Then, they help each other to watch over their houses. On the other hand, big cities are impersonal because of their size. People cannot meet each other easily.
Last but not least, Small towns are friendlier than big cities, and encourage a sense of community. People tend to be more relaxed in small towns and have more time to meet people whereas in big cities, people are more hurried. For instance, small towns are easier to get around in than big cities. When people want to visit their friends, they often ride a bicycle to meet them because of closeness.
